ls is een Linux-shellopdracht die de directory-inhoud van bestanden en directory's weergeeft.
$ ls [options] [file|dir]
ls commando belangrijkste opties:
keuze | beschrijving |
---|---|
ls -a | maak een lijst van alle bestanden, inclusief verborgen bestanden die beginnen met '.' |
ls --kleur | gekleurde lijst [=altijd/nooit/auto] |
ls -d | lijst mappen - met ' */' |
ls -F | voeg een teken van */=>@| toenaar enteren |
ls -ik | het ino-indexnummer van het lijstbestand |
ls -l | lijst met lang formaat - machtigingen weergeven |
ls -la | lijst lang formaat inclusief verborgen bestanden |
ls -lh | lijst lang formaat met leesbare bestandsgrootte |
ls -ls | lijst met lang formaat met bestandsgrootte |
ls -r | lijst in omgekeerde volgorde |
ls -R | lijst recursief mappenboom |
ls -s | lijst bestandsgrootte |
ls -S | sorteren op bestandsgrootte |
ls -t | sorteren op tijd en datum |
ls -X | sorteren op extensienaam |
U kunt op de tab -knop drukken om de bestands- of mapnamen automatisch aan te vullen.
Lijst directory Documenten/Boeken met relatief pad:
$ ls Documents/Books
Maak een lijst van directory /home/user/Documents/Books met een absoluut pad.
$ ls /home/user/Documents/Books
Lijst hoofdmap:
$ ls /
Lijst bovenliggende directory:
$ ls ..
Maak een lijst van de thuismap van de gebruiker (bijvoorbeeld: /home/user):
$ ls ~
Lijst met lang formaat:
$ ls -l
Toon verborgen bestanden:
$ ls -a
Lijst met lang formaat en toon verborgen bestanden:
$ ls -la
Sorteer op datum/tijd:
$ ls -t
Sorteer op bestandsgrootte:
$ ls -S
Maak een lijst van alle submappen:
$ ls *
Recursieve mappenboomlijst:
$ ls -R
Toon alleen tekstbestanden met jokertekens:
$ ls *.txt
ls omleiding naar uitvoerbestand:
$ ls > out.txt
Lijst alleen mappen:
$ ls -d */
Maak een lijst van bestanden en mappen met het volledige pad:
$ ls -d $PWD/*
Selecteer ls options en druk op de knop Code genereren :
Advertising